‘Round the clock action at Atlantic City’s largest resort

Grab a map to explore this immense complex of gaming and good times right on the beach and Atlantic City Boardwalk. Gamers can take a seat at one of 3,000 slot machines in the 148,256-square-foot casino, while picky eaters delight in choosing from among 21 restaurants. After dark, 13 bars, lounges and clubs cater to bachelor and bachelorette parties with great success, earning the resort six nightlife awards from Atlantic City Weekly. A mix of karaoke, dancing, IMAX movies, live comedy and DJs offers non-stop action until dawn.

Rooms

A whopping 2,100 rooms in four towers open to views of the beach, boardwalk or city. Both the standard rooms and classic rooms in the North Tower deliver basic accommodations. For free Wi-Fi and the best views, request a classic room in the newer Havana Tower, with forest green carpet and a light floral motif.

Features

As part of the Tropicana, The Quarter shopping complex calls out with a brightly colored streetscape reminiscent of Old Havana, with palm trees, a Latin band and rooftop lounge. Stroll the shops or book some pampering at bluemercury spa. In summer, guests flock to the pool and beach bar. Rent beach chairs or a VIP cabana. Dining

Adam Good Crab Shack & Sports Bar
This restaurant offers guests an affordable menu of seasonal shellfish dishes, a rustic raw bar and an incredible crab selection including Dungeness, Blue Claw, Snow and King. Executive Chef and Culinary Institute of America graduate Kevin Couch has designed a menu to suit all palates. The 240-seat restaurant will feature an authentic crab shack atmosphere, complete with brown paper spread across tables, hammers for whacking shells, bibs and pitchers of frosty cold beer. A lively bar area will be the perfect place for sports fans to grab a bite and watch the game on big screen televisions.

FIN: A Seafood Experience
FIN features locally grown food and wine from New Jersey fishermen, farmers and vintners. It is the only seafood restaurant in Atlantic City with oceanfront seating. Signature dishes include Chef Demetrios' Dancing Shrimp made with onion panko crusted shrimp served with a lobster crab cake. There is also a sushi and raw bar. Come experience seafood with a splash. Open for dinner.
Golden Dynasty
Voted Best Chinese Restaurant in Atlantic City eight years in a row by Casino Player Magazine, Golden Dynasty elevates traditional Chinese cuisine to exquisite levels. Prepared by some of Atlantic City's most distinguished chefs, the succulent fare explores the Cantonese, Mandarin and Szechwan cuisines.

The Palm
The Palm's new restaurant in The Quarter at Tropicana is the legendary restaurant's first foray into New Jersey. Renowned as much for its A-List celebrity regulars and caricature adorned walls as it is for prime steaks, enormous lobsters and traditional Italian dishes. Known as the ultimate celebrity hang-out, the Palm has garnered the Wine Spectator Awards of Excellence award for its wine list and is known as the critics choice as The Classic American Steak House.

Tropicana Atlantic City Review

Although I stay in hotels for business every week, I don't provide reviews for many, as most are either good or very good to excellent (I provide reviews for the excellent ones). I stayed at the AC Trop for a weekend night because I wanted to enjoy a little R & R. Now I understand that the casino hotels are extremely pricey because of their location to everything worth doing, but for $300/night I expected to enjoy at least some semblance of amenity or at the very least, a very nice room. Unfortunately, this was not the case. Check-in was a snap, but Hillary, the check-in attendant, was not at all friendly or offered any additional info such as a mere question of 'can I answer any questions for you' or options for upgrades, or anything else. When you are staying at a resort, this is expected, not an option. Upon entering the room, I noticed that the wall paper was peeling off of the walls, along with a loud, clearly old A/C unit that struggled to work properly. The shower head pressure was very good, but that was it, and for me, added that. The bed was not comfortable at all, and the pillows were almost painfully 'bouncy'. I am not a fussy hotel guest, but I guess I just expected at least as nice a room as I stay in for business during the week. This was not the case at the AC Trop. I guess my expectation may have been too high at this price point for a casino hotel on the boardwalk, but I am pretty sure that I won't stay at the Trop again. The clincher and icing on the cake was that I asked for a late check-out (normal checkout is 11:00am and I wanted to check out at noon) because one of my family members is disabled, and it sometimes takes longer to get them ready the next morning. This was not an option, and when I asked the front desk, they simply said that they were not allowing any late checkouts for anyone. If I was not so tired from spending my money at their casino the night before (I actually won!), I probably would have pursued it and asked as to why, but I was just not in the mood and knew after that discussion, I was never going to stay at the Trop AC again. I just did not want to spend an arm and a leg for basically a hotel room in a prime location...maybe next time I'll try Resorts or some other place in that price range. Not recommended.
